富士スピードウェイホテル

Fuji Speedway Hotel

A luxury escape for motorsport enthusiasts, blending modern elegance with stunning views of Mount Fuji.

Hotel

Luxury, Mountain View, Motorsports, Modern Design, Spa

MK Guide Recommends

Fuji Speedway Hotel - The Unbound Collection by Hyatt offers a unique blend of luxury and adrenaline, set against the backdrop of Mount Fuji. With direct access to the iconic Fuji Speedway, this hotel is a haven for motorsport aficionados and those seeking refined accommodations. Guests can indulge in contemporary rooms and suites, savor fine dining experiences, and relax at the spa, all while enjoying panoramic views of Japan’s most famous peak. This property perfectly balances a sophisticated design with the excitement of racing culture, creating an unparalleled experience in the heart of Shizuoka.
